Non-hormonal therapy reduces hot flashes and night sweats in women who have been diagnosed with breast cancer

by Cheryl Critchley, Monash University Credit: Pixabay/CC0 Public Domain A Monash University-led trial of a new drug known as Q-122 therapy significantly reduced the number and severity of hot flashes and night sweats in women who have been diagnosed with breast cancer.
